All throughout the year, Paris’ calendar of events is full to the brim. Bastille Day is the big one. On this date in July, there’s a parade along the Champs Élysées and fireworks at the Eiffel Tower, to celebrate France’s independence. Or we can create a private custom tour, anywhere ...How to Day Trip from Paris to Normandy. 1. First take the train from Paris into Bayeux or Caen. These are the two historic cities nearest to the Normandy beaches. Both are easily accessible by train from Paris but the one way train ride takes roughly 2.5 hours. Mar 1, 2024 · A Paris Museum Pass is the most affordable way to see them all as it provides access to over 50 museums in Paris and the surrounding region. A two-day pass costs 52 EUR, a four-day pass costs 66 EUR, and a six-day pass costs 78 EUR. It’s a must if you’re going to see at least 3 museums while in the city. Getting to Paris On a Budget.27 Paris Tips You Need to Know. 1. Spring and Fall are the best times to visit Paris to avoid crowds. I know you can’t always be flexible with your travel dates, however, if you can steer clear of visiting Paris in July and August I highly recommend it. Ideally, try visiting Paris in April-May or September-October.

Just outside of Paris, 40 minutes driving from the centre, or 10 to 45 minutes on the train from Gare Montparnasse to Versailles-Chantiers or La Verrière, is the esteemed Palace of Versailles.
